Transaction 32ca71aa06446ce4d89f965e58dc181022204f8b16114874b66fd4f573d84473

2 Input
2 Outputs
  • 32ca71aa06446ce4d89f965e58dc181022204f8b16114874b66fd4f573d84473:0
  • value  6915
    address  17CH6EVptm4oCSnCG4FoQapJWmYKsHST4J
  • 32ca71aa06446ce4d89f965e58dc181022204f8b16114874b66fd4f573d84473:1
  • value  272370
    address  14aD2g7LHm7Vy9Fm6YyKhaSDdfpiwWi1CF